The Azienda Vinicola Ilauri Tavo is a delightful white wine crafted from the Pinot Grigio grape variety, hailing from the picturesque Delle Venezie region. This vintage, from 2009, offers a light-bodied profile that showcases a refreshing balance of bright acidity and moderate fruit intensity. The wine presents an elegant bouquet of citrus and stone fruits, rounded out with subtle hints of floral notes, creating a captivating olfactory experience. With a dry mouthfeel and clean finish, this expression of Pinot Grigio is incredibly versatile and pairs wonderfully with a variety of dishes, making it an excellent choice for any occasion. Its charm lies in the harmonious interplay of flavors, reflecting the unique terroir of Delle Venezie.

Delle Venezie

Part of the larger Tre Venezie IGT area, delle Venezie offers high quality and more regional character through tighter production rules. The region covers the Veneto, Friuli-Venezia Giulia and Trentino areas—a large swathe of northeastern Italy lying between the Alps and the Adriatic Sea. Fresh mountain breezes and cool sea air help temper the sunshine here and maintain fresh acidity in the wines, while day-night temperature variation brings aromatic intensity. As well as Pinot Grigio (which accounts for seven out of every ten bottles made), Pinot Noir does well too. Also look out for sparkling Pinot Grigio Spumante and Frizzante.
